developer /dɪˈvɛləpɚ/  

  • noun
    plural -ers
    a person or thing that develops something: such as
    [count] :a person or company that builds and sells houses or other buildings on a piece of land
    a real estate developer
    [count] :a person or company that creates computer software
    a software developer
    [noncount] :a chemical that is used to develop photographs